566 GNGTS 2016 S essione 3.2 For the site in Fondi it could show to a good approximation how the cisterns were “seen” by the single methods; furthermore, the matching of the anomalies confirms the presence of structures. For the Santa Balbina site instead the overlays do not show good matching anomalies, however, it could be useful to discern the differences between the datasets, especially, in this case, in terms of resolution. One disadvantage of this method is that the images might become too confusing if many datasets are overlaid. RGB Colour Composites.
